Search a number
-
+
100101122121033 = 32111011122445667
BaseRepresentation
bin10110110000101010011011…
…110100110101110101001001
3111010102120111022102112012200
4112300222123310311311021
5101110024044230333113
6552521453132430413
730041032060035525
oct2660523364656511
9433376438375180
10100101122121033
1129993713896430
12b288327318409
1343b1659280017
141aa0cc4cccd85
15b88cd72ae873
hex5b0a9bd35d49

100101122121033 has 12 divisors (see below), whose sum is σ = 157735101524208. Its totient is φ = 60667346739960.

The previous prime is 100101122121023. The next prime is 100101122121043. The reversal of 100101122121033 is 330121221101001.

100101122121033 is a `hidden beast` number, since 100 + 101 + 1 + 221 + 210 + 33 = 666.

It is an interprime number because it is at equal distance from previous prime (100101122121023) and next prime (100101122121043).

It is not a de Polignac number, because 100101122121033 - 28 = 100101122120777 is a prime.

It is a junction number, because it is equal to n+sod(n) for n = 100101122120997 and 100101122121015.

It is not an unprimeable number, because it can be changed into a prime (100101122121023) by changing a digit.

It is a polite number, since it can be written in 11 ways as a sum of consecutive naturals, for example, 505561222735 + ... + 505561222932.

It is an arithmetic number, because the mean of its divisors is an integer number (13144591793684).

Almost surely, 2100101122121033 is an apocalyptic number.

It is an amenable number.

100101122121033 is a deficient number, since it is larger than the sum of its proper divisors (57633979403175).

100101122121033 is a wasteful number, since it uses less digits than its factorization.

100101122121033 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1011122445684 (or 1011122445681 counting only the distinct ones).

The product of its (nonzero) digits is 72, while the sum is 18.

Adding to 100101122121033 its reverse (330121221101001), we get a palindrome (430222343222034).

The spelling of 100101122121033 in words is "one hundred trillion, one hundred one billion, one hundred twenty-two million, one hundred twenty-one thousand, thirty-three".

Divisors: 1 3 9 11 33 99 1011122445667 3033367337001 9100102011003 11122346902337 33367040707011 100101122121033